    I am on Lopez Island, Washington, where there are no local appliance repair people. You are a lifesaver; I took my new wife to my vacation home here for our honeymoon. I rent the place out as a vacation rental, and discovered last night that the Kitchen Aid Dishwasher would fill with water, and then immediately shut down and drain the water. It was a blockage of the food disposal impeller blade. Once I cleared that out, put it all back together, everything works well again. Thank you so much!

    Thank you soooo much for this video!! We were actually just about to buy a new dishwasher because we thought the motor was out. I did some searching online and found your video. My hubby watched it and followed your instructions. He found 2 plastic tabs that had broken off the top rack jammed inside the grinder so it was locked down. Once he removed those, works like a charm!! Yay!! Such a poor design for the rack adjusters and wheels to be made from plastic that breaks off and shuts the whole thing down, but that's not your fault. Just wanted to express my gratitude!!

    This was very helpful for the future. My machine suddenly wasn't working, but then I don't use it but maybe twice a year. After I removed the front panels and checked all wires were live and connected, I then thought to check the electrical plug at the wall and it was ajar! Can you believe it? Check that first, and if something else, like maybe your garbage disposal that's connected to the same socket works, well, then you remove the front panels and go from there. ;b Thank goodness I didn't call someone out before checking UA-cam. :)

      Alaways keep the door shut and locked even when not in use. Water can drain into the machine from the sink and leak out the bottom of the door if it isn’t locked. And this means you have your drain hose improperly installed. It should have a high loop going higher than the bottom of the sink under the counter
